    Dolphin Point Beach

    63 Seaside Parade, Dolphin Point NSW 2539, Australia

    Dolphin Point Beach, nestled in the serene coastal town of Dolphin Point, NSW, is a hidden gem that promises an unforgettable seaside experience. Visitors can expect soft golden sands, crystal-clear waters, and stunning views of the Pacific Ocean, making it an ideal spot for sunbathing, swimming, and beachcombing. The beach is renowned for its vibrant marine life, including playful dolphins often spotted frolicking just offshore, providing a delightful opportunity for wildlife enthusiasts and photographers alike. Key features include well-maintained picnic areas, shaded spots for relaxation, and easy access to walking trails that meander along the coastline. With its tranquil ambiance and breathtaking natural beauty, Dolphin Point Beach is perfect for families, couples, and solo travelers seeking a peaceful escape. Whether you're enjoying a leisurely stroll at sunset or indulging in a seaside picnic, this beach is a must-visit destination for anyone exploring the New South Wales coastline.

    Burrill Beach

    Dolphin Point NSW 2539, Australia

    Burrill Beach, nestled in the picturesque Dolphin Point, NSW, is a hidden gem that promises visitors a perfect blend of relaxation and adventure. Stretching along the pristine coastline, this expansive beach boasts soft golden sands, crystal-clear waters, and stunning views of the surrounding natural landscapes. Ideal for families, Burrill Beach offers safe swimming areas, and rock pools teeming with marine life, making it a fantastic spot for snorkeling and exploring. Nature enthusiasts will appreciate the nearby nature reserves and walking trails that showcase the region's rich biodiversity. With ample picnic spots and barbecue facilities, it’s a perfect setting for a leisurely day by the sea. Whether you're seeking a serene retreat or an active day of water sports, Burrill Beach is a must-visit destination for locals and tourists alike, promising unforgettable memories and breathtaking scenery.
